Vacheron Constantin's "The Quest" exhibition lands in Shanghai, a timeless journey through 270 years of excellence

17 July 2025

After captivating audiences in Abu Dhabi and Tokyo, Vacheron Constantin's magnificent exhibition, "The Quest: 270 years of seeking excellence," has gracefully made its way to Shanghai, China. This isn't just an exhibition; it's an immersive voyage through nearly three centuries of unparalleled watchmaking artistry, a true celebration of time itself.

Prepare to be mesmerized as you explore an exquisite collection of iconic timepieces, witness the intricate beauty of sophisticated calibers, and delve into fascinating historical documents from the Maison’s prestigious archives. This exhibition stands as a profound tribute to Vacheron Constantin’s enduring legacy, brilliantly showcasing the brand's unwavering dedication to both masterful craftsmanship and relentless innovation.

Visitors will have the unique opportunity to trace the Maison’s rich connection with China, discovering special timepieces thoughtfully tailored to resonate with Chinese culture. Plus, you’ll get an exclusive deep dive into the métiers d’art, revealing a shared journey of artistic brilliance that spans continents.

Don't miss your chance to experience this horological marvel! The exhibition is open until July 20, 2025, at Zhang Yuan, a historic and culturally significant landmark right in the heart of Shanghai.
